The Scottish Government uses data collected by local authorities to publish an annual list of registered disused land and buildings, to assess the scale of the issue and keep track of remediation. Site Type This categorisation is intended to combine factual appreciation of the recorded information and planning status of a site, with a considered view of the likelihood of its development (appraised and updated as required at the time of the Survey each year). Fearn was renamed HMS Owl after the Royal Navy took control in 1942, during which time it served as a torpedo training facility and housed several thousand service personnel.
